When thinking about board-up alternatives, it's essential to comprehend the various products and methods readily available. Below is a comparison of typical board-up solutions:
Solution TypeDescriptionProsConsPlywood Board-UpUtilizing sheets of plywood to cover windows and doors.Long lasting and easily readily available.Can be large and heavy to handle.Metal Board-UpMetal sheets used for increased security.Strong and resistant to break-ins.May require professional installation, greater cost.Polycarbonate Board-UpClear plastic sheets that permit light in while protecting openings.Visually pleasing, light-weight.More costly than plywood.Window Security FilmA clear movie applied straight to glass.Cost effective and simple to apply.Not a complete replacement for physical barriers.Factors to consider for Choosing a SolutionExpense: Analyze your budget and the possible costs of each option.Duration: Determine for how long the board-up will be required. Temporary solutions may suffice for short-term problems.Location: Assess the property's surroundings and possible risks.Ease of access: Consider the ease of gain access to when installing and removing the boards.Actions for Emergency Board-Up
Implementing a board-up option requires cautious preparation and execution. Here's a step-by-step guide to efficiently board up a property:
Assess Damage: Identify all areas that require boarding up.Gather Materials: Secure necessary materials such as plywood, screws, a saw, and a drill.Procedure Openings: Accurately procedure doors and windows to ensure the boards fit.Cut Plywood: Cut the plywood to size based on your measurements.Secure Plywood: Use screws to securely attach the plywood to the structure. Ensure it's securely fitted to prevent wind and debris from entering.Check Stability: Once installed, check to make sure all boards are secure and steady.Suggested Tools and MaterialsPlywood sheets (3/4 inch thickness recommended)Wood screwsPower drill or screwdriverMeasuring tapeSaw (hand saw or circular saw)Safety safety glasses and glovesWhen to Call Professionals

Q: How long does a board-up last?A: A board-up can be a temporary solution for weeks to months, depending upon weather condition conditions and structural integrity.

Q: Do I require a license for board-up?
A: Generally, no license is needed for temporary boarding. However, examining local regulations is recommended.

Q: Can I eliminate the boards myself?A: Yes, if
you have the right tools and the structural damage has been fixed, you can safely get rid of the boards.

Q: How much do board-up services normally cost?A: Costs can vary
from ₤ 150 to ₤ 600 depending on the size of the area and materials used.

Q: What if my windows are already broken?A: Immediate boarding is crucial to prevent further damage and secure your property. Call a professional service if needed.
